North Korea reaffirms Russia ties under Kim
AFBytes Brief
The Russian leader praised bilateral relations and thanked North Korea for assistance. The North Korean diplomat conveyed Kim's ongoing commitment to the partnership.
Why this matters
Expanded North Korea-Russia cooperation can influence global sanctions regimes and arms supply dynamics that affect U.S. security planning.
